#42e141 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#42e141 is composed of 25.9% red, 88.2% green and 25.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 71.1%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 119.6 degrees, a saturation of 72.7% and a lightness of 56.9%. #42e141 color hex could be obtained by blending #84ff82 with #00c300.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#42e141 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#42e141 has RGB values of R:66, G:225, B:65 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0, Y:0.71,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 4383041.
